DUCK (a la Bearnoise)
Stew a duck in a little broth, half a glass of white wine, and a bunch of herbs (bouquet garni). Put into another stewpan seven or eight large onions cut in slices, and a bit of butter, put on the fire, and turn often till they get a good colour. Add a pinch of flour, moisten with the liquor the duck was stewed in. Stew the onions, and reduce the sauce; skim off the fat, and add a squeeze of lemon; pour it over the duck, and serve. Probable cost, 5s.
